    Pleeease tell me! Where do you get your leads from? That powerful supersaw of yours?

    B0UNC3 responds:

    Thank you :D, yeah that 4/4 to triplet transition is pretty smooth haha. I'll tell you. The lead is made up of 4 sylenth1 patches :)
    1 Buzzlead, 1 Triangle/pulse (to add some more highend bite), 1 Supersaw, 1 Supersaw at a lower octave to fill out the lowend towards the bassline. Slam those into a maximizer. and sidechain some heavy reverb too for an even fatter sound. I hope that atleast clarified something :D

    PS: SIDECHAINING is super important :D
